Buying Guide

Height, Proportions, and Spatial Fit

The most critical specification for any christmas tree design is its height relative to your ceiling. Always subtract at least twelve inches from your ceiling height to account for a tree topper and adequate clearance. Beyond raw height, consider the diameter at the base. A wider tree requires more floor space and pushes furniture outward, while narrower pencil designs fit snugly into corners. When reading specs, verify whether the listed height includes the stand, as some manufacturers measure from the floor to the top tip while others measure only the foliage.

Material Composition and Branch Construction

Artificial trees primarily use PVC, PE, or a blend of both. PVC branches are cut from flat sheets, creating a classic, slightly artificial look that is generally more affordable. PE branches are injection-molded from real tree molds, offering superior realism at a higher cost. Blends, like those found in some models above, place realistic PE tips on the outer edges where they are visible, hiding cheaper PVC branches near the trunk. Additionally, hinged branches fold down automatically for faster setup, whereas hook-in branches require manual attachment but often allow for denser customization.

Lighting Configurations and Electrical Safety

If you opt for a pre-lit christmas tree design, pay close attention to the bulb count and type. More bulbs generally mean fewer dark spots; a six-foot tree typically benefits from several hundred lights for even coverage. Warm white LEDs remain the most popular choice for traditional aesthetics, while cool white suits modern decor. Check whether the wiring uses a series or parallel circuit. Parallel circuits ensure that if one bulb burns out, the rest of the strand remains lit, saving significant troubleshooting time. Always verify that the power adapter carries appropriate safety certifications for indoor household use.

FAQ

What is the most realistic material for an artificial tree?

Polyethylene, commonly listed as PE, is widely considered the most realistic material because the branches are molded directly from real evergreen clippings. Trees that use a blend of PE on the outer edges and PVC near the trunk offer an excellent balance of lifelike appearance and affordability. Pure PVC trees tend to look flatter and more manufactured by comparison.

How many lights should a six-foot tree have?

A general guideline suggests roughly one hundred lights per foot of tree for standard illumination, meaning a six-foot tree should ideally feature around six hundred bulbs for a very bright display. However, many pre-lit models use fewer bulbs strategically placed to achieve a warm, balanced glow without overwhelming the branches. Always check owner reviews to see if buyers felt the included lighting was sufficient.

Are hinged trees better than hook-in trees?

Hinged trees are significantly faster and easier to assemble because the branches are permanently attached to the center pole and simply fold downward into place. Hook-in trees require you to insert individual branches into color-coded slots, which takes more time and effort. However, hook-in designs sometimes allow for a denser, more customizable final shape once fully assembled.

Can I use acrylic crystal picks on a real tree?

Yes, acrylic picks work equally well on both real and artificial trees, as they simply tuck between the existing branches. Because acrylic is lighter than glass, it will not weigh down delicate real pine or fir needles as heavily. Just ensure the wire stems are wrapped securely around a sturdy inner branch to prevent them from slipping out over time.
